Multicenter study of general anesthesia. I. Design and patient demography

Summary
This large clinical trial compared four anesthetic agents: enflurane, fentanyl, halothane, and isoflurane. Pooling data across institutions confirmed the validity of comparing their efficacy and safety in patients.

Purpose of the Study:
- To conduct a prospective randomized clinical trial comparing four anesthetic agents: enflurane, fentanyl, halothane, and isoflurane.
- To assess the efficacy and relative safety of these agents in a large patient cohort.
- To determine the validity of pooling data from multiple institutions for anesthetic research.
Main Methods:
- Prospective randomized clinical trial involving 17,201 patients across 15 university-affiliated hospitals.
- Patients were stratified into groups with and without preanesthetic medication.
- Randomization to one of four study agents: enflurane, fentanyl, halothane, or isoflurane.
- Data collection included preoperative assessment, intraoperative monitoring, immediate recovery, and up to 7 days post-anesthesia.
Main Results:
- The study included a diverse patient population (mean age 43 yr, 65% female, 90.7% ASA Physical Status 1 or 2).
- Data were collected systematically across multiple time points and institutions.
- The pooled data analysis was deemed valid for comparing the anesthetic agents.
Conclusions:
- Pooling data from multiple institutions in this trial was valid.
- The study successfully allowed for the determination of the efficacy and relative safety of enflurane, fentanyl, halothane, and isoflurane.
